Shane Withington (born 22 August 1958) is an Australian actor, currently best known for playing surf lifeguard John Palmer in Home and Away on the Seven Network; his former role as Brendan Jones in the television series A Country Practice,[1] the Deputy Matron of Wandin Valley Hospital; as well as Willing and Abel, as Abel Moore, and the sitcom The Family Business.

He had a guest star appearance in Strange Bedfellows,[2] alongside Paul Hogan and Michael Caton. In 2008, he was in the BBC drama Out of the Blue, playing the detective in charge of investigating a murder. Since 2009, he has had the regular role on Home and Away. He had appeared in the series previously as a character known as Colin.

Withington co-starred in the play The Boys Next Door in 1992.

Personal life[]

He is married to Anne Tenney, who played his character's wife Molly Jones on A Country Practice.[3]
